A Quick Chat With The Dandys

The Dandys have just been added to the Splendour lineup, and have dropped their hard-hitting, razor-sharp single ‘Smile More’. The Brisbane/Meanjin-based punk/alt-rock outfit have been making a huge impact over the past year and continues to check off massive milestones. With a fierce and unapologetic attitude, The Dandys tackle the urgent subject of sexual assault in a ferocious and empowering manner. By merging catchy melodies with a profound message, The Dandys aim to raise awareness, encourage dialogue, and challenge societal norms. We caught up with the band to find out more about the track, their influences and more.


Can you tell us what this track means to you and what you want people to take away from it?

This track discusses some tough topics around sexual assault and toxic masculinity however we wanted to discuss it in an accessible way where people can feel empowered, heard or just let out some of the frustrations they may have around the subjects. With the chorus deliberately being a slew of unsavoury phrases that get thrown around far too often, we want to create a safe space for people to be able to scream these and take the power away from the words. I guess that's our goal with the song. Open the dialogue, empower people and draw attention to the topic in a non-accusatory way.

What's the creative process for you, from writing through to recording?

Pretty much every song has a different process. This song though, it was the first song we wrote for the band. Mads brought the track to the group Felix, Henry and Nick put their parts together to create the end product. In the studio, we collectively re-worked the track until we felt like there was nothing left to get rid of and nothing more to say with the track, we went through the recording process several times to land on a version we were happy with.

What else do you have planned for 2023?

We are lucky enough to be added to the Splendour in the Grass 2023 lineup so that's exciting! Aside from that, we've got another single and our debut EP Sex and Feuds to be released very very soon. Hopefully finish off the year with an East Coast tour and a big ol' hometown show in Brissy to top it all off!
